Twin over Full Bunk Beds
Twin over Full bunk bed plans describe how to build a bunk bed that has a full bed on the bottom with a twin bed on the top. This style is also available as a stackable bunk bed.

Bunk Bed Plans and Loft Bed Plans
In this age of crowded space it seems there is just never enough room for everything. Small quarters in children's rooms, apartments, vacation homes and dorms make bunk beds a very practical option. Our loft bed plans accommodate furniture such as a desk or other accessories below. Our triple bunk bed plans allow for three people to sleep in the footprint of a standard twin size bed. All bunk and loft bed plans include ladder ends for easy access and added space conservation. All of our bunk and loft bed plans adhere to the CPSC safety rules with full guard rails on each side.
